Abstract

Despite sustained national agricultural growth in Ethiopia, smallholder productivity remains far below potential. Using cross-sectional data from 265 randomly selected farm households in the Geba catchment (Tigray) collected during the 2017/18 cropping season, this study estimates technical efficiency and examines the effect of crop diversification on efficiency. A Cobb-Douglas stochastic frontier model with simultaneous inefficiency effects (Battese and Coelli, 1995) was applied. Mean technical efficiency was 67% (range 20–90%), indicating that output could rise by approximately 49% without additional inputs if inefficiency were eliminated. Age of household head and access to irrigation reduce inefficiency, while distance to market increases it. Most importantly, the number of crops cultivated is negatively and significantly associated with technical inefficiency, confirming that crop diversification markedly enhances efficiency, primarily through better seasonal utilization of family labour and risk spreading. Policies promoting crop diversification, small-scale irrigation, and market access are recommended to boost productivity in rain-fed smallholder systems.
